As Tesla Cybertruck Market Collapses, Used Price Gets Real
- Tesla's Cybertruck resale prices have dropped sharply to around $74,000 as of late May 2025 in the U.S. used market.
- The price decline follows heightened controversies around Elon Musk's political involvement and Tesla's recall issues that damaged brand perception.
- Originally priced at $100,000, some 2024 Cybertruck Foundation Series models resold near $150,000 last year but are now losing over 30% value annually.
- Electrek reported Tesla offers $65,400 trade-ins for 2024 Cybertrucks, reflecting a 34.6% depreciation well above typical 20% annual drops in traditional pickups.
- These steep declines and public backlash suggest Tesla faces significant challenges maintaining Cybertruck's market strength amid evolving EV competition and political controversies.
